Trey - Really like the way your bike turned out with the extended saddle bags, filler strips and LED lights - looks great.  I'm considering doing the same modifications. Do you have the part number for the filler strips and LED lights?  Thanks

Hey Thanks, these  are the parts I used . I got the price from Zanotti

60465-09 fasica 156.99
59818-09 stud plate x2 15.12
60919-09 stiffner plate x2 29.48
7499 nutx6 6.60
11891 spacerx3 4.95
69383-09 LH light 129.15
69407-09 RH light 129.15
3152 screws x6
70338-09 wire harness 38.49
